Output d789f97c11466845a6834291e2ed86e27e6660e6119c3d8e836e121f0be1b92d:35

value
617592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c28d35502a831a9aefa30a77c7b2a78bf0f80c76 OP_EQUAL
address
3KRiB5cexMCPYjuMeoZF9LsL88Wu4u7K2u
transaction
d789f97c11466845a6834291e2ed86e27e6660e6119c3d8e836e121f0be1b92d
spent
true